The Tower Foreman will be responsible for the management of a tower construction crew. Provides direction and supervision. Directs the completion of assigned projects. Coordinates with customers and suppliers. Maintains a safe and productive work environment. Trains crew members. Maintains vehicles and equipment in good working order. Performs tower construction work. 85% of working environment is outdoors. Continuous travel. Pay is Commensurate with experience
Duties
Build an antenna support structure (monopole, self-supporting, guyed and or tree towers) with the use of a crane.
Build a guyed tower using a crane and a gin pole with knowledge of slings, shackles, grip hoists and all other aspects of rigging for gin poles.
